In square close-packed layer, a molecule is in contact with four of its neighbours. Therefore, the two-dimensional coordination number of a molecule in square close-packed layer is 4.

The layer that is thinnest under the oceans is the crust. While it is thinnest in those underwater regions, it is the thickest in the regions where mountains are.
